Services Offered:
- Intercity Bus Transportation: Specializes in providing express bus services primarily between Las Vegas, NV, and various cities in Southern California, including Los Angeles, Rowland Heights, and Monterey Park.
- Regular Schedules: Offers daily departures, ensuring consistent travel options for passengers. Specific schedules should be confirmed directly with W&H, as times can vary.
- One-Way and Round-Trip Tickets: Provides options for both single journeys and return trips to cater to different travel needs.
- Comfortable Seating: Buses are equipped with air-conditioned seating to ensure a comfortable journey, especially during the long drive through the desert. Some services may offer "sleeper and semi-sleeper beds" or seats with "extra legroom" and "power outlets" depending on the specific bus operator (as W&H may partner with others, like FlixBus, as a ticket retailer).
- Luggage Allowance: Typically includes a standard allowance for luggage (e.g., one hand bag and one hold luggage per person). Additional luggage may be subject to extra fees (e.g., $10-$20 per piece).
- Rest Stops: Journeys usually include designated rest stops, such as at the Barstow outlets, allowing passengers to stretch, use restrooms, and grab refreshments.
- Direct Routes: Aims to provide relatively direct routes with minimal stops to ensure efficient travel times.
